There is no special code you could add to your web page to point out up right here, nor are you able to pay for this placement, but paying consideration to the question intent can help you better construction your content material for featured snippets. For example, if you’re trying to rank for "cake vs. pie," it might make sense to include a table in your content material, with the advantages of cake in a single column and the benefits of pie within the different. Or if you’re trying to rank for "best restaurants to strive in Portland," that could point out Google wants an inventory, so f
tting your content material in bullets could assist.

First get together knowledge refers to knowledge collected directly from the buyer, not despatched to you by a third-party. It can be utilized to serve up a extra personalized expertise for the patron when visiting an net site or app. This contains issues like survey responses, social media posts, and other feedback mechanisms.
